Engine and Transmission

Pulsar 150 BS6 is powered by a 4-Stroke, 2-Valve, Twin Spark BSVI Compliant DTS-i FI, 149.5 cc engine. It can produce a max power of 14 PS @ 8500 rpm and torque of 13.25 Nm @ 6500 rpm. It is noted to be a 5-speed transmission. The mileage of the bike is 50 kmpl. Likewise, it has a Compression Ratio of 9.8 +/- 0.3: 1 with Stroke of 60.7 mm and bore of 56 mm. Dimension and Design

Talking about the measurements, the length of the Bajaj Pulsar 150 BS6 std is 2055 mm with a width of 765 mm. Also, the height of the bike is 1060 mm and wheelbase is 1320 mm. Similarly, the Ground Clearance of Bajaj Pulsar 150 BS6 STD is 165 mm with a weight of 148 kg. The seat height of the bike is 785 mm.

Brakes, Wheels & Suspension

Pulsar 150 BS6 has telescopic Conventional fork suspension on the front and Twin shock absorber, gas-filled with Canister suspension on the rear. Moreover, the front brake of the Pulsar 150 BS6 is a 260 mm disc/ 280 mm disc and rear is a 130 mm Drum/ 230 mm disc with alloy wheels. Likewise, the Tyres are tubeless with front tire size 80/100-17  and rear tire size 100/90-17. in STD variant. In Twin Dis variant the tire size is 90/90 17 front and in Rear 120/80 17. Other features

Pulsar 150 BS6 has a fuel capacity of 15 liters with Fuel Gauge. The bike also has Digital speedometer and Analogue Tachometer. There are halogen headlamp and LED tail lamp. Moreover, the bike has only electric start. The bike has other features 12V Full DC battery, AHO (Automatic Headlight On), DRLs (Daytime running lights) and so on.
